John 20: 21 – 22 Peace be with you! As the Father has sent me, I am sending you. And with that he breathed on them and said, “Receive the Holy Spirit”.
When you were “saved”, “born again” or “became a Christian” the Holy Spirit came to dwell in you making you a new creation. He has created in you an awareness of how much you are loved by God. Along with the peace that brought to you there also came the awareness that you are now part of something really big and wonderful. You are part of the family and kingdom of God, in the same way that a body has parts and the parts have functions to perform.
When Jesus met with his disciples after his resurrection, he told them that just as his Father had sent him, he was now sending them into the world. For that they needed special empowerment, so he breathed on them and said “Receive the Holy Spirit”. Ask the Lord to breathe upon you and fill you with the Holy Spirit so you will be able to daily do the things He wants you to do. That is the essence of walking in the Spirit – it is daily, paced, forward movement requiring constant refreshing along the way.
